Output 3dd89666030c7293100313eb0c06700c7d1cc15786ea9b464cd51e73c18bb571:2

value
10603467
script pubkey
OP_0 OP_PUSHBYTES_20 08d9ae46a35a2a4185eddd0dafa0fe1813a3b7c4
address
bc1qprv6u34rtg4yrp0dm5x6lg87rqf68d7yhegu4g
transaction
3dd89666030c7293100313eb0c06700c7d1cc15786ea9b464cd51e73c18bb571
spent
true